The Sears Craftsman LT 2000 is a 42-inch riding lawn tractor designed for residential use, featuring a 19.5 HP Briggs & Stratton engine, 6-speed manual transmission, electric start, 3-in-1 cutting deck (mulch, bag, side discharge), adjustable cutting height (1.5-4 inches), and a comfortable high-back seat. Below are key sections for safety, features, operation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and specifications.
Key components: 19.5 HP Briggs & Stratton engine, 42-inch cutting deck, 6-speed manual transmission, electric start, high-back seat, headlights, cup holder.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Engine | 19.5 HP Briggs & Stratton, single-cylinder, overhead valve |
| Cutting Width | 42 inches |
| Transmission | 6-speed manual shift-on-the-go |
| Starting System | Electric key start with backup recoil |
| Cutting Height | Adjustable from 1.5 to 4 inches (6 positions) |
| Deck Type | 3-in-1 (mulch, bag, side discharge) |
| Fuel Capacity | 2.5 gallons |
| Seat | High-back, adjustable |
| Headlights | Two front headlights for low-light operation |
| Warranty | 2-year limited warranty |

Familiarize yourself with all controls before starting.
Dashboard: Ignition key, headlight switch, hour meter, choke.
Control Levers: Lift lever (deck height), parking brake, gear shift (1-6), clutch/brake pedal.
Starting Procedure: 1. Sit on seat. 2. Engage parking brake. 3. Set gear to neutral. 4. Pull choke (cold start). 5. Turn key to start. Stopping: Release clutch/brake, engage parking brake, turn key off.

Regular maintenance ensures long life and optimal performance.
| Interval | Task |
|---|---|
| Before each use | Check tire pressure, fuel level, deck for debris |
| Every 8 hours | Check engine oil level |
| Every 25 hours | Change engine oil (first 5 hours), sharpen blades |
| Every 50 hours | Replace air filter, check spark plug |
| Every 100 hours | Replace fuel filter, check transmission fluid |
| Seasonally | Lubricate pivot points, check battery |
WARNING! Disconnect spark plug wire before performing any maintenance.

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Engine won't start | Dead battery, empty fuel, clogged filter | Charge/replace battery; add fuel; replace fuel filter. |
| Poor cutting performance | Dull blades, low engine speed | Sharpen/replace blades; set throttle to full speed. |
| Excessive vibration | Unbalanced blade, loose parts | Check blade for damage/tightness; tighten deck bolts. |
| Loss of power | Dirty air filter, old spark plug | Clean/replace air filter; replace spark plug. |
| Hard to shift gears | Low transmission fluid | Check fluid level; add if low (consult manual). |
